Revealing Email Campaign Efficiency

Uncovering Email Project Efficiency involves assessing crucial metrics and efficiency indications to assess the effectiveness of e-mail advertising and marketing initiatives. When diving into e-mail campaign efficiency, it is essential to examine metrics such as open rates, click-through prices, conversion prices, and unsubscribe rates. Open prices show the portion of recipients who opened up the e-mail, providing understanding right into the effectiveness of subject lines and sender names. Click-through rates gauge the percentage of recipients who clicked links within the e-mail, showing interaction levels. Conversion rates track the percentage of receivers who finished a preferred activity after clicking on a web link in the e-mail, such as authorizing or making a purchase up for a newsletter. Unsubscribe prices highlight the number of receivers that chose out of receiving additional e-mails, shedding light on email material high quality and relevance. By evaluating these metrics, marketing experts can tweak their e-mail campaigns for far better engagement and efficiency.

Discovering Straight Web Traffic Patterns

Checking out the straight web traffic patterns in Google Analytics offers valuable understandings into user behavior and the efficiency of campaigns - what is not considered a default medium in google analytics. Straight web traffic describes visitors that come down on a site by straight keying the link into their browser, utilizing bookmarks, or clicking untagged links. Recognizing direct web traffic patterns can help marketing experts evaluate the impact of offline advertising and marketing efforts, brand name acknowledgment, and the efficiency of word-of-mouth recommendations
